Runbook: Account Recovery — Bramblewick Assignment Service

If the admin account for the Splitlane A/B assignment service gets locked (usually after three bad 2FA attempts), don't panic — experiment bucketing keeps running from cache for 24 hours. Open the recovery console from the release bastion, pick "break-glass restore," and confirm the current experiment epoch matches the dashboard. Assignments stay sticky throughout, so no user reshuffling. At the final prompt, the console asks for the recovery passphrase below.

unlock words, yadup-yagef: zorael-druix

Subject: Cron → Windlass cut-over wrapped

Hi Priya,

Good news — the last batch of cron jobs is now running on the Windlass workflow engine as of this morning. All 34 jobs migrated, zero missed runs, and the old scheduler box is in drain mode until Friday. Retries and alerting are handled by Windlass now. Final engine settings are pasted below for the release record.

settings of tagef-bawif:
DRUIX_HOST=druix.zemvarlabs.internal
DRUIX_PORT=8000

# Settings: report export timezone handling
#
# Future maintainers: all report exports from Tallygrove are generated
# in UTC and converted to the tenant's display timezone at render time,
# never at query time. Do not "fix" this by storing local timestamps;
# the Pemberforth incident was caused by exactly that. DST boundaries
# are handled by the chrono shim in exporters/tzmap. The exporter reads
# tenant timezone preferences from the reporting replica, not the
# primary. The replica is reached via the connection string below.

replica DSN, kajep-yahag: mssql://praok_svc:iF@db-8d68.plorvaio.local:5432/eliion

Confirm that the Saltbridge canary pipeline enforces all three gates before promotion: error-rate delta under 0.5% versus baseline, p99 latency within 10% of control, and a minimum 30-minute soak at 5% traffic. Verify that gate thresholds are sourced from the versioned policy file, not ad-hoc overrides, and that any manual override from the last cycle carries a written justification. Attach the gate evaluation logs as evidence. Accountability for maintaining and approving these gating rules rests with the individual named below.

named custodian: Brivan Eliath Quenox Frador